Step 1
Juice strawberries until you make about 2 ounces of juice. Fresh juice ferments more quickly than store bought juices.
Step 2
Add the 2-4 ounces of juice to a 16 ounce bottle. (Make sure it is a good bottle for fermenting.)
Step 3
Pour just under 14 ounces of Water Kefir into the bottle leaving a small amount of room (about 1 inch) at the top.
Step 4
Let sit on a counter for 1-3 days. Check it often by opening it to see if it is bubbly.
Step 5
Drink or refrigerate within 1 week for maximum probiotic benefit and taste!
